## Moving film reels to the Ostbrook Archive

Quick guide for sending reels over. Each reel goes in its original canister, canisters upright in the padded transit crate — never on their side, the old acetate stock hates it. Label the crate "fragile, keep cool" and book the climate van. The courier hand-over instruction sits just below.

dispatch memo: the lamwyn fenwyn courier leaves the wenir ledger at gate 7175 under passcode 822969

/*
 * Memory constants for the Verdane spreadsheet exporter.
 *
 * Export jobs stream rows in chunks rather than materializing the
 * full workbook, since large tenant exports previously exhausted
 * worker heaps and stalled the release pipeline. Chunk size, heap
 * ceiling, and spill-to-disk thresholds are all tunable here; note
 * that raising the chunk size trades memory for throughput. These
 * values must match the deploy manifest for each release. Current
 * settings follow.
 */

tuning constants:
BUDGETS = {
    "druath": 240,
    "lamwyn": 180,
    "silael": 275,
}

**Alert: ProctorQueue backlog exceeding threshold.** This fires when the Veriloom exam-proctoring review queue holds more than 500 unreviewed sessions for over 15 minutes. Sustained backlog usually means the ingest workers in the Harwick cluster have stalled, or a large exam cohort finished simultaneously. Check worker health first, then consider scaling the reviewer pool before candidates hit the appeal window. Detailed triage steps, including safe restart order, are documented on the runbook page.

runbook for tajep-yahig: https://artifactory.lumictech.corp/repo

Quarterly Planning Note — Sales Leads

Subject: Launch of the Corvela Plus subscription tier

Corvela Plus enters pilot in week six of the quarter, targeting mid-market accounts currently on the standard plan. Pricing sits 40% above standard, justified by priority routing and the new analytics bundle built by the Ashvale team. Please prepare upgrade shortlists from your territories by the 15th and flag any accounts with renewal friction. The strategic context for this launch is set out in the confidential note below.

board note of baweg-bawig: Project Tamath slips by six weeks because of the audit delay.